What is Pharmacy2U
Overview
Pharmacy2U is an online pharmacy service known for handling prescriptions and home delivery of medicines. It operates a UK service (pharmacy2u.co.uk) and a South African-facing site (pharma2u.co.za).

Will I get a refund?
Refunds on the South African site
Pharma2U .co.za refers refunds and exchanges to its Return Policy; specific refund rules are not published in the public Terms & Conditions.
Because details are not explicit, request written confirmation from customer support about any refund eligibility and timing.
Refunds under the UK service (for comparison)
- UK shop orders have a 14-day notification plus 14 days to return (28-day cooling-off guidance for non-prescription items); return postage is generally at the customer’s expense.
- Prescription or dispensed medicines in the UK are generally non-refundable unless faulty or damaged on arrival.
- Private consultation fees can be cancelled within 14 days if the consultation has not been completed; prescription charges are often non-refundable once issued.

Comparative recap
Quick comparison
| Feature | Pharma2U (.co.za) - South Africa | Pharmacy2U (.co.uk) - UK |
|---|---|---|
| Cancellation policy (public) | No explicit cancellation policy found in public Terms & Conditions; refers to Return Policy. | Private consultation cancellable within 14 days; subscriptions cancellable before cut-off via account. |
| Refunds for prescriptions | Return/exchange governed by Return Policy; specifics not publicly available. | Prescription/dispensed items generally non-refundable unless faulty or damaged on arrival. |
| Cooling-off right | Not specified in public terms. | 14-day right to change your mind for many non-prescription purchases (subject to exceptions). |
| How to cancel | Contact customer support; no detailed online cancellation flow published. | Account management for subscriptions; customer care for orders and consultations. |
